Bpo Agent applicants have rated the interview process at iQor with 3 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) and assessed their interview experience as 100% positive. To compare, the company-average is 68.6% positive. This is according to Glassdoor user ratings.
Candidates applying for Bpo Agent roles take an average of 1 day to get hired, when considering 2 user submitted interviews for this role. To compare, the hiring process at iQor overall takes an average of 7 days.
Common stages of the interview process at iQor as a Bpo Agent according to 2 Glassdoor interviews include:
Personality test: 33%
One on one interview: 33%
Skills test: 33%

The person who was interviewing me was very approachable and nice. He was guiding me along the way and even gave tips on how it would be during the final interview.
I applied in-person. The process took 1 day. I interviewed at iQor (Manila, Manila) in Oct 2024
Interview
Asked for background, simple introduction, asked problem solving questions, then reviewed my CV and further probed my previous job experienced to get in depth with. After that they asked for any Training certification I might have from an accredited facility, then I was given a QR code to scan which contains basic BPO questionaires to answer which would allow.
